The National Commission for Privatization on the 29th October 2021 continued its nationwide tour of State Owned Enterprises (SOEs) with a visit to Sierra Leone Airports Authority (SLAA).

While addressing the Sierra Leone Airport Authority Management (SLAA), the Chairman and Commissioner, Dr. Prince Alex Harding re-echoed the mandate of the Commission, which is to ensure that State Owned Enterprises (SOEs) under the First Schedule of the NCP Act of 2002 become efficient in their service delivery and financially contribute to the development of government projects.

He went on to assure the SLAA of the Commission’s full support.

“As a Commission, we will be always around to ensure our SOEs become productive and efficient,” he disclosed.

On the political front, the NCP Chairman and Commissioner, Dr. Prince Alex Harding who also doubles as the SLPP National Chairman said that his appointment at the NCP was influenced by two major factors.

One of those factors according to him is his requisite knowledge in Privatization dated back to 2002 when he was serving as the Minister of information and Communications.

According to Dr. Prince Alex Harding, the NCP’s core mandate is to make sure that all State-Owned Enterprises (SOEs) are functional well devoid of any political influence. As it is the only means that can enable the SOEs to provide the State with its much-needed revenue and also not to renegade on the provision of jobs.

Another key mandate that is visible, but very strategic among his roles in the NCP as the SLPP National Chairman. Dr. Harding belief that his role at the NCP is to formulate and implement policies that can maximize the welfare of citizens which can be translated into delivering on President Julius Maada Bio and the SLPP manifesto promises.

In her statement, the Executive Secretary of the Commission, Madam Safura B Rogers, appreciated the management of SLAA for hosting the NCP family at the Freetown International Airport, stressing the need for effective collaboration and cooperation.

“I am extending an olive branch to all Heads of our SOEs to come to my office and discuss challenges hindering your operations, and I believe we can map out ways to address these concerns,” she added.

Responding on behalf of the Board Chairman of SLAA, Haja Darling Quee extended an appreciation to the Commission for the visit as the Authority considered it timely.

She called on the Commission to provide full support to SLAA and help address their concerns.

The tour was concluded with an inspection on the airport extension project by the Chairman and Commissioner, Dr. Prince Alex Harding.
